FACTS ABOUT ACTORS WHO SUCCESSFULLY NAVIGATED CHALLENGES

Viola Davis, a powerhouse of the stage and screen, overcame a childhood of poverty and abuse to become one of the most decorated actresses of her generation, winning an Emmy, an Oscar, and a Tony Award.

Lin-Manuel Miranda, the creator and original star of the groundbreaking musical "Hamilton," turned his lifelong passion for storytelling into a cultural phenomenon that has captivated audiences worldwide.

Lupita Nyong'o, a relative newcomer to the industry, burst onto the scene with her Academy Award-winning performance in "12 Years a Slave," proving that talent and determination can transcend traditional barriers.

Dwayne "The Rock" Johnson, a former professional wrestler, has seamlessly transitioned into a beloved and versatile movie star, showcasing his acting chops in a wide range of genres and roles.

Chadwick Boseman, the late and deeply lamented star of "Black Panther," used his platform to celebrate and empower the Black community, leaving an indelible mark on the industry and beyond.

Emma Stone, a self-proclaimed "awkward" child, has embraced her unique quirks and vulnerabilities to become one of Hollywood's most sought-after leading ladies, winning an Oscar for her work in "La La Land."

Daniel Kaluuya, a British actor of Ugandan descent, has captivated audiences with his powerful performances in films like "Get Out" and "Judas and the Black Messiah," earning numerous accolades, including an Academy Award.

Margot Robbie, a relative unknown when she was cast in the critically acclaimed "The Wolf of Wall Street," has since become a versatile and acclaimed actress, producing her own projects and championing diverse storytelling.

Riz Ahmed, a British actor and musician of Pakistani descent, has used his platform to advocate for greater representation and inclusion in the entertainment industry, while also delivering standout performances in films like "The Sound of Metal."

Zendaya, a former Disney Channel star, has seamlessly transitioned into a leading lady in prestigious projects like "Euphoria" and "Malcolm & Marie," showcasing her remarkable talent and emotional range.

QUESTIONS ABOUT ACTORS WHO SUCCESSFULLY NAVIGATED CHALLENGES

What inspired Viola Davis to pursue acting, and how did she overcome the challenges of being a Black woman in a predominantly white industry? Viola Davis has been open about the difficulties she faced as a young Black woman trying to break into the acting world, where opportunities were limited and the industry was often resistant to stories and characters that didn't fit the traditional mold. However, she was driven by a deep passion for storytelling and a desire to give voice to the experiences of marginalized communities. Davis persevered through countless rejections and stereotypical roles, eventually becoming one of the most celebrated and awarded actresses of her generation.

How did Lin-Manuel Miranda's unique perspective and diverse cultural influences shape the creation of "Hamilton"? Lin-Manuel Miranda has always been a voracious reader and student of history, with a deep fascination for the complexities and contradictions of the American founding fathers. By blending his love of hip-hop, his Puerto Rican heritage, and his boundless creativity, Miranda was able to craft a groundbreaking musical that not only entertained audiences but also challenged traditional narratives and sparked important conversations about race, representation, and the power of the arts to transform our understanding of the past.

What personal challenges did Lupita Nyong'o face as a relative newcomer to the film industry, and how did she overcome them to achieve such remarkable success? As a relative newcomer to the film industry, Lupita Nyong'o faced numerous obstacles, from the pressure of delivering a career-defining performance in her very first major role to the challenge of navigating the often-treacherous waters of Hollywood stardom. However, Nyong'o's unwavering commitment to her craft, her poise under pressure, and her genuine passion for storytelling helped her to overcome these challenges and cement her status as a rising star. Her Oscar win for "12 Years a Slave" was a powerful testament to her talent and resilience.

How has Margot Robbie used her platform and production company to champion diverse storytelling and create opportunities for underrepresented voices in the entertainment industry? Margot Robbie's rise to stardom has been marked by her commitment to using her platform to amplify diverse voices and perspectives in the entertainment industry. Through her production company, LuckyChap Entertainment, Robbie has helped to finance and produce films that challenge traditional Hollywood narratives and provide opportunities for underrepresented talent, both in front of and behind the camera. Her willingness to take on complex, multifaceted roles and to use her influence to champion marginalized stories has made her a powerful force for change in an industry that has historically been resistant to such efforts.
